Abercynon to Roose by train

A train trip from Abercynon to Roose takes about 8hrs 23 mins on average, covering roughly 170 miles (275 kilometres). With around 14 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£32.20,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Abercynon to Roose start from as little as £32.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Abercynon to Roose start from £130.40 one way, or £186.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Abercynon to Roose are available for £134.90 one way, or £269.80 return

Station Facilities and Services

Abercynon Station may not boast a bustling ticket office, but it simplifies the process with modern ticket machines that support quick and easy ticket collections. These machines have been cleverly designed to accommodate all travelers, offering accessible ticketing with support for major debit and credit cards, although they don't accept cash. For tech-savvy travelers, the presence of smartcard validators ensures a seamless transition between different parts of the journey.

The station’s facilities cater to everyday commuter needs. While there are no dedicated waiting rooms, there is ample seating available. Travelers can rest assured with the availability of CCTV and help points, providing a safe and informed environment. Unfortunately, the station lacks luggage storage, refreshment facilities, and luxury lounges, but travelers can rely on the extensive transport links for their onward journeys or plan stops at nearby amenities.

Accessibility and Support

Abercynon aims to provide accessible travel to as many passengers as possible. It offers step-free access and ramps with handrails are available for both platforms, classifying it as Category B2 on the accessibility scale. Although wheelchair availability and waiting rooms are absent, the station compensates with accessible parking options. The staff helpdesk and comprehensive customer information through screens and announcements ensure that travelers with different needs are catered to.

Facilities and Amenities at Roose Station

Roose Station is equipped with ticket machines for easy collection of tickets purchased online, making the process seamless for travelers. While there is no staffed ticket office, the station ensures accessibility options such as induction loops, and step-free access in parts of the station, which is crucial for passengers with mobility impairments. Although there are no waiting rooms, seating is provided for your convenience.

The station, though not equipped with certain amenities such as refreshment facilities or toilets, encourages travel with confidence through the provision of assistance. Passengers can receive help directly from train staff or use the available helpline. Connecting at Roose: Transport Links

Roose Station offers convenient onward travel connections. If you're continuing your journey by bus, take advantage of services like the local bus line facilitated via Busline by calling 0871 200 2233. Taxis are available through services like Cab4You, ensuring you reach your final destination effortlessly. Although bicycle hire isn’t available at the station, the locality offers several attractive routes for cycling enthusiasts.

For times when rail replacement services are necessary, passengers can board these at designated bus stops along Roose Road.
